    def create_tunneled_connection(self, url, port, response):
        s = FakeSocket(response)
        conn = AWSHTTPConnection(url, port)
        conn.sock = s
        conn._tunnel_host = url
        conn._tunnel_port = port
        conn._tunnel_headers = {'key': 'value'}

        # Create a mock response.
        self.mock_response = Mock()
        self.mock_response.fp = Mock()

        # Imitate readline function by creating a list to be sent as
        # a side effect of the mocked readline to be able to track how the
        # response is processed in ``_tunnel()``.
        delimeter = b'\r\n'
        side_effect = []
        response_components = response.split(delimeter)
        for i in range(len(response_components)):
            new_component = response_components[i]
            # Only add the delimeter on if it is not the last component
            # which should be an empty string.
            if i != len(response_components) - 1:
                new_component += delimeter
            side_effect.append(new_component)

        self.mock_response.fp.readline.side_effect = side_effect

        response_components = response.split(b' ')
        self.mock_response._read_status.return_value = (
            response_components[0], int(response_components[1]),
            response_components[2])
        conn.response_class = Mock()
        conn.response_class.return_value = self.mock_response
        return conn
